For each parent, determine which alleles their sperm or eggs could carry. Remember that each gamete receives only one allele per gene.
Identify the traits and assign letters. Use a capital letter for the dominant trait and a lowercase for the recessive one (e.g., P for purple, p for white).

Homozygous individuals have two identical alleles ( TT or tt ), while heterozygous individuals have one of each ( Tt ).

Place one parent's gametes along the top and the other's down the side. Fill in the boxes to see potential offspring combinations.
